These four are all duplex stainless steels. When sorted by alloy content and corrosion resistance from low to high: 2101 < 2304 < 2205 < 2507. What they have in common is that their strength is twice that of 316L, and they possess excellent resistance to stress corrosion cracking. To put it simply: 2101 is an "economical lightweight option", 2304 is an "entry-level alternative", 2205 is an "all-round mainstay", and 2507 is a "super premium grade". The core differences lie in their Pitting Resistance Equivalent Number (PREN) and applicable scenarios.   🧪 Core Properties and Application Comparison · 2101 (Cost-effective economic grade): PREN approximately 26. Manganese and nitrogen are used to replace part of the nickel content, resulting in the lowest cost, while its yield strength is twice that of 304. Corrosion resistance is slightly better than 304 but significantly lower than 316L. Mainly used for bridge railings, truck frames, storage tanks, and other applications focusing on weight reduction and high toughness under mild corrosive conditions.· 2304 (Entry-level duplex steel): PREN approximately 25. Corrosion resistance falls between 304 and 316L, with slightly lower strength than 2101 but better toughness. Suitable for replacing 304 to reduce wall thickness, used in water heaters, heat exchangers, pulp digesters, and other medium and low temperature working conditions.· 2205 (Most widely used mainstream grade): PREN approximately 35. Its resistance to pitting and crevice corrosion far exceeds that of 316L, with outstanding resistance to chloride-induced stress corrosion cracking. It is the dominant choice for chemical pipelines, offshore platforms, flue gas desulfurization systems, and other medium to high corrosive environments, and is the most mature in the market.· 2507 (Super premium grade): PREN as high as 42+. It represents the top level in terms of corrosion resistance and strength among duplex steels. Specially designed for extremely harsh environments such as high-pressure seawater desalination pumps, subsea oil and gas pipelines, and strong acid heat exchangers, where 316L would suffer perforation within weeks.   💡 How to Choose? · Mild corrosion, primary goal is weight reduction (replacing 304/Q235) → 2101, the most affordable with high strength.· Better corrosion resistance than 304 required with limited budget (replacing 304) → 2304, cost-effective entry-level option.· Typical chemical/marine environments, balancing performance and cost → 2205, the first choice with the most extensive processing experience.· Seawater or strong acid conditions where 316L fails and extremely high strength is required → 2507 (however, it costs nearly twice as much as 2205 and is extremely difficult to process).   ⚠️ Key General Precautions · Overheating is strictly prohibited: Duplex steels cannot be used long-term above 300°C, as harmful sigma phase precipitation will cause embrittlement.· Strict welding control: Interpass temperature must be below 150°C and heat input limited to ≤1.5 kJ/mm, otherwise corrosion resistance will degrade.· Processing differences: Higher strength grades (such as 2507) experience faster work hardening and demand higher-performance cutting tools.
